Questions about Baxter

  • What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?

    American Staffordshire Terrier mixes like Baxter tend to do well in homes where they receive plenty of attention from their owners. They’re comfortable in houses with securely fenced yards but can also adapt to apartment living if given enough exercise and engagement.

  • How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?

    Baxter’s breed enjoys having outdoor space to play, such as a fenced yard, but regular walks and activities are just as important. If committed to daily exercise, Baxter could thrive without a large yard.

  •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?

    American Staffordshire Terrier mixes like Baxter are often good with children, especially when properly socialized. Baxter does get along with children and can make a loyal family companion.
